The Goddard Collaborative

Over the past two years, a group of colleges, universities, K-12 schools, museums, libraries, municipalities, and other non-profit organizations in Central Massachusetts and nearby regions have come together to collaborate on high-speed networking opportunities.

History• NEESCom builds a competitive fiber network

• WPI and NEESCom establish Goddard GigaPop LLC for Internet2 access (1999)

• Great plans for fiber development fade away– Fiber construction slows and competitive providers fail

– GigaPoP “commercial” business model does not work

– WPI purchases NEESCom’s share (2002)

– WPI restructures GigaPoP business model– Convenes group of colleges for NSF grant application => “customers”

– Deadline missed, but awareness generated!

– Group keeps meeting; grows; develops broader agendas

– WPI still the only Goddard GigaPoP “customer”

Vendor CategoriesVendor CategoriesPowered By– Recognizing key vendors : NEESCom, Charter, Intellispace,

Verizon

Partner- Unrestricted Donation– Unrestricted cash donation of at least $5,000 to the collaborative

annually.

Sponsor – Restricted Donation– Donation of at least $5,000 to the collaborative in some restricted

form, done annually.

Vendor– Discount to collaborative members over and above what is

generally available to any private entity or Higher Ed. Customer. This discount must be renewed annually.

Grants PursuedGrants Pursued

Grants Received Holy Cross and Assumption awarded $172,000 National Science Foundation - HPNCCollaborative Institute of Museum and Library Services grant with Higgins - The Higgins Armory Museum and WPI will share a $316,000.And a three year, $620,000 grant from Mass DOE for Math and Science Partnerships with thirteen Mass K-12s and MEC.
